NLnetLabs / routinator

An RPKI Validator and RTR server written in Rust
https://nlnetlabs.nl/projects/routing/routinator/
BSD 3-Clause "New" or "Revised" License
447 stars 69 forks source link

routinator exiting #960

Open matsm opened 1 month ago

matsm commented 1 month ago

Hi,

I am running Routinator 0.13.2 in a FreeBSD 13.3-RELEASE-p2 vnet jail. I have built the binary from source.

Every other day or so the following happens:

From /var/log/messages

Jun 2 02:30:21 XX routinator[64012]: Fatal: failed to move /var/spool/routinator/repository/stored/tmp/29f396a2 to /var/spool/routinator/repository/stored/rrdp/rrdp.apnic.net/020675249928c63c162a11d00ab299c0b2d0e2c3ca4d27a8ebf933ace26a66a6/rsync/r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ft: No such file or directory (os error 2) Jun 2 02:30:23 XX routinator[64012]: Fatal error. Exiting.

Please advice

/ Mats Mellstrand

partim commented 1 month ago

That’s certainly very odd. If it happens again, can you perchance check whether the target directory (i.e., in your example /var/spool/routinator/repository/stored/rrdp/rrdp.apnic.net/020675249928c63c162a11d00ab299c0b2d0e2c3ca4d27a8ebf933ace26a66a6/rsync/rpki.apnic.net/repository) exists? And perhaps also whether the source file is still there?

matsm commented 1 month ago

Hi

Sorry for late answer.

It happend again. And the directory do exist and the source file is still there.

/mm

On 3 Jun 2024, at 17:09, Martin Hoffmann @.***> wrote:

That’s certainly very odd. If it happens again, can you perchance check whether the target directory (i.e., in your example /var/spool/routinator/repository/stored/rrdp/rrdp.apnic.net/020675249928c63c162a11d00ab299c0b2d0e2c3ca4d27a8ebf933ace26a66a6/rsync/rpki.apnic.net/repository) exists? And perhaps also whether the source file is still there?

— Reply to this email directly, view it on GitHub https://github.com/NLnetLabs/routinator/issues/960#issuecomment-2145448596, or unsubscribe https://github.com/notifications/unsubscribe-auth/AA2U6DMXFE5NNYKGB6SZWPTZFSBKXAVCNFSM6AAAAABIUXQSN2VH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MZDCNBVGQ2DQNJZGY. You are receiving this because you authored the thread.